About the role

The AVP, Expense Management & Accounting is a leadership role within Retail Advice & Solutions, accountable for leading the Insurance accounting function and expense management discipline. This role provides strategic financial leadership, functional expertise, and disciplined oversight to support business performance, strengthen decision-making, and advance key priorities across the organization. The incumbent will partner closely with senior leaders to shape expense strategy, deliver clear and actionable insights, and drive accountability for forecasting, planning, reporting, controls, and cost optimization. Success in this role requires strong leadership presence, sound judgment, operational excellence, and the ability to influence outcomes across multiple stakeholder groups while maintaining a robust control environment and high standards of governance.

What you'll be doing
  • Lead, coach, and develop a high-performing team, fostering a culture of accountability, collaboration, innovation, talent development, and continuous improvement
  • Provide senior-level leadership and governance over financial reporting cycles, accounting processes, ledger controls, and the overall internal control environment
  • Design, sponsor, and oversee end-to-end control and accounting process enhancements, ensuring effective implementation, adoption, and sustainable operational outcomes
  • Own the full expense management mandate, including monthly expense reporting, forecasting, planning, budgeting, performance analysis, and business partner engagement
  • Drive disciplined expense management and cost optimization across Retail Advice & Solutions, identifying efficiency opportunities and enabling productivity savings
  • Prepare and present executive-ready materials for senior management, translating trends, risks, opportunities, and business drivers into clear recommendations and actionable insights
  • Build trusted relationships with senior business partners, Finance leaders, and cross-functional stakeholders to influence decisions, align priorities, and deliver high-quality service to the business
  • Champion process simplification, automation, and continuous improvement to strengthen operational efficiency, scalability, and financial management effectiveness


What you'll need to succeed
  • Professional accounting designation or related credential, with 10+ years of progressive experience in senior finance, accounting, expense management, or financial leadership roles
  • Proven people leader with demonstrated ability to attract, retain, coach, and develop high-performing teams while building succession depth and leadership capability
  • Strong executive communication skills, with the ability to synthesize complex financial information and present insights, recommendations, and trade-offs clearly to senior audiences
  • Sound business judgment and management acumen, with the ability to prioritize competing demands, make informed decisions, and lead through ambiguity in a fast-paced environment
  • High degree of discretion, professionalism, and integrity in handling confidential financial, business, and people-related information
  • Demonstrated track record leading complex initiatives, process improvements, or cross-functional projects from strategy through execution and sustainable adoption
  • Strong operational expertise in financial reporting, accounting systems, controls, and automation, with a continuous improvement mindset and focus on scalable, efficient processes
  • As this position is posted in several locations, we specify that bilingualism (French, English, both oral and written) is required for Quebec only as the position includes managing both French and English-speaking staff (Quebec and outside Quebec) and providing daily support to the team.
